Stratford District Council awarded for its armed forces support

THE SUPPORT Stratford District Council gives to the armed forces is award winning.

It has received a silver award from the Ministry of Defence’s Employer Recognition Scheme.

The prestigious award recognises employers who have actively demonstrated support for the armed forces community by implementing policies to help them.

To achieve the silver award, organisations must proactively demonstrate that the armed forces community is not unfairly disadvantaged as part of their recruitment policies.




They must also actively ensure their workforce is aware of their positive policies towards the defence community and understand issues for reservists, veterans, cadet force adult volunteers, and spouses and partners of those serving in the Armed Forces.

In November 2024, SDC signed the Armed Forces Covenant, a commitment to those who serve or have served in the British military, and to their families. By signing, the council commits to treating those who serve, or have served in the armed forces, and their families with fairness and respect.


SDC leader Coun Susan Juned said: “Being recognised by the Ministry of Defence with this award is a fantastic achievement which demonstrates our ongoing commitment to our serving personnel and veterans, following our bronze award last year.

“The district council understands the huge sacrifices made by service personnel and their families to keep our country safe and it is only right we do what we can to support them both during and after their time in uniform.”
